(TGF)-beta is a pluripotent cytokine exerting differential effects on distinct components of the immune response. The present report, based on lymphokine determination in culture supernatants and Northern blot analysis of lympokine mRNA, demonstrates that TGF-beta-2 markedly inhibits interleukin (IL)-4 and IL-5 synthesis by polyclonally activated human T cells in the absence of any significant effect on (IFN)-gamma, lymphotoxin or IL-2, suggesting a modulatory effect of TGF-beta-2 on the interferon T(h)1/T(h)2) balance of immune responses. The inhibitory effect of TGF-beta on IFN-gamma production by unfractionated peripheral blood mononuclear cells is likely to reflect the blunting of natural killer cell activation by TGF-beta.
